This interstate route from Cheyenne, Wyoming to Fayetteville, North Carolina spans over 1,400 miles, involving cross-country logistics and coordination. Understanding the distance, timing, and service options is essential for a successful move.
The estimated distance of 1,466 miles reflects the typical driving route between these cities.
This is an interstate move because it crosses state lines from Wyoming to North Carolina.
Due to the long distance, professional movers plan for multiple days of transit to ensure safety and compliance with driving regulations.

Moving costs for this long-distance route range from $1,673 to $2,270 depending on the size of your household. Small moves fall on the lower end, medium moves in the mid-range, and large moves at the higher end of the price spectrum. Variations in price reflect differences in volume, packing needs, and additional services like storage or expedited delivery. Planning ahead and selecting the right service can help manage your budget effectively.

Here are answers to common questions about moving from Cheyenne, Wyoming to Fayetteville, North Carolina to help you plan your relocation.
Costs vary by home size and services but generally range from $1,673 for small moves up to $2,270 for large moves. Additional services like packing or storage can increase the price.
Standard delivery usually takes about 3 days, while expedited options can reduce this to 2 days, depending on the moving company and scheduling.
Choosing a self-service move where you pack yourself and opt for standard delivery typically offers the lowest cost. Avoiding peak moving seasons can also reduce expenses.
Booking several weeks in advance is recommended to secure better pricing and availability, especially for interstate moves like this one.
Yes, reputable moving companies operating on this route are required to be licensed interstate movers, ensuring compliance with federal regulations.
Plan for transit time, coordinate packing and loading schedules, and consider storage options if needed. Communication with your moving company is key to a smooth process.
